    Essential Functions and Duties:

    Prep Work & Ingredient Management

    Wash, chop, portion, label, and store ingredients in accordance with recipes.

    Assist in preparing sauces, dressings, batters, and other foundational items.

    Follow food safety procedures for storage, labeling, and rotation (FIFO).

    Maintain prep lists and communicate completion status with the Chef/Kitchen Manager

    Kitchen Operations

    Arrive for a shift on time and in uniform.

    Keep prep areas clean, stocked, and organized.

    Assist with receiving and storing deliveries.

    Support line cooks during peak hours by restocking or preparing needed items.

    Step in to assist dishwashers during rushes or when coverage is needed.

    Wash prep tools, cutting boards, and equipment throughout the shift.

    Cleanliness & Organization

    Maintain sanitation standards throughout all prep areas.

    Assist with deep cleaning tasks as assigned.

    Help with end-of-shift breakdown and storage.
